Book Talk with David Leonhardt "Ours Was the Shining Future: The Story of the American Dream"
David Leonhardt will speak about his book "Ours Was the Shining Future: The Story of the American Dream." Leonhardt is a senior writer at The New York Times, where he writes its flagship newsletter, “The Morning.” He has also been the newspaper’s Washington bureau chief, an op-ed columnist, a staff writer for The New York Times Magazine, and the founding editor of “The Upshot.” He has won the Pulitzer Prize for commentary. This is his first book.
